Internet Retailer magazine has a Top 500 Guide of the top ecommerce firms on the Web today and they have statistics on the top products sold. In 2005 (their 2006 report will be released sometime in June), following are the top products sold on the Web http://www.internetretailer.com/top500/index.asp
Mass merchant/department store = $18.267 billion in sales
Computers/electronics = $17.667 B
Office supplies = $10.323 B
Apparel/accessories = $7.061 B
Books/CDs/DVDs = $2.500 B
Housewares/home furnishings = $2.416 B
Specialty/non apparel = $2.325 B
Food/drug = $1.872 B
Health/beauty = $1.748 B
Flowers/gifts = $1.203 B
Sporting goods = $1.336 B
Hardware/home improvement = $0.851B
Toys/hobbies = $0.740 B
Jewelry = $0.615 B
The above numbers can hopefully give you some idea of the best products to sell on the Web. However, you will be running a small business and you're coming in late in the game, so I suggest you find some niche market in the above categories that are currently underserved or ignored by the big boys such as Amazon.com or Sears.com
